Pull the IM to verify if the valley pan gasket/oil filter gaskets are leaking. It takes 10-20min depending on your experience. I would be willing to bet this is the source of your leak; as said above, might as well replace the check valves while you're in there if it's the valley pan gasket. If it's not, then pulling the IM will allow you to get a better look to see if the crank seal is leaking.
